Choosing between Constant Contact and Mailjet is a common decision for email marketing buyers in 2026. Constant Contact has been in the market since 1995, giving it a 15-year head start over Mailjet (founded 2010). Constant Contact serves 600K+ users while Mailjet has 150K+ users globally. Constant Contact differentiates with email campaigns and event marketing, while Mailjet leads with collaborative email editor and transactional api. AI Verdict

After comparing Constant Contact and Mailjet across features, pricing, and user satisfaction, Mailjet takes the lead with a score of 86/100 versus Constant Contact's 82/100. Mailjet's key advantages include "real-time email collaboration" and "good transactional api". That said, Constant Contact has its own strengths — particularly "very beginner-friendly" — making it a viable alternative for specific use cases.

On pricing, there's a clear difference: Mailjet offers a free plan, making it more accessible for individuals and small teams exploring email marketing solutions. Constant Contact starts at $12/mo with no free tier, but often justifies the cost with email campaigns and event marketing.

Bottom line: Choose Constant Contact if you need nonprofits and local businesses running events and email campaigns. Go with Mailjet if your priority is marketing teams needing collaborative email design with transactional delivery.
